| dc.description.abstract | This paper presents a CMOS output stage devised for driving heavy resistive loads. An operational amplifier of this type has been fabricated in a 3 /spl mu/m double-polysilicon CMOS technology. With a supply voltage of /spl mnplus/5 V and load of 470 /spl Omega/, the amplifier has a /spl mnplus/4.6-V output swing and features a 60 mA short-circuit output current. Although simple, the proposed configuration enables the output transistors to be driven efficiently. | |
